As a Lead Vehicle Test Technician, reporting to the Manager Vehicle Development, you will be assigned a range of duties, including instrumentation of vehicles for testing in various disciplines, dynamics, durability, noise and vibration, performance. You will work with a dedicated group of engineers and technicians to solve data acquisition problems. You will also support various engineering prototype builds.

The ideal candidate can show proof of excellence in your past position, while demonstrating profound creativity in resolving mechanical problems, diagnosing faults, and implementing vehicle test hardware.

The Role

  • Build state of the art automotive prototype vehicle, systems, and subsystems
  • Work closely with Design engineers and identify potential assembly and service issues
  • Work efficiently within a multidisciplinary cooperative environment
  • Evaluate engineering prototypes on the road to acquire various types of data
  • Service instrumentation systems and wire harnesses

Qualifications

  • Proficient with wiring and sensor installation and check out
  • Good vehicle mechanics knowledge
  • Able to quickly diagnose and fix vehicle problems that arise during test activities
  • Able to diagnose and fix wiring problems
  • Must be willing to work flexible hours including weekends and possible overtime including supporting test trips to various EU locations. Estimated travel 20%.
  • Basic computer skills for issue reporting
  • Must demonstrate the ability to communicate clearly both written and orally
  • Exceptional ability and desire to learn new skills and tools ability to apply oneself in new problems in a dynamic lean start-up environment
  • Proof of excellence in your past position, while demonstrating profound creativity in resolving mechanical problems
  • 5+ years automobile (EV) technician experience,
  • Valid EU driver’s license

Education

  • Master Technician Certification (Kfz-Mechatroniker Meister)
